Iain MacArthur's linework reminds me of everything from Louis Wain and art nouveau to Klaus Voormann to Jim Woodring, but isn't overburdened by references. The Google image search result grid is unusually remarkable! And you can follow him on Tumblr. [Behance via Scene 360]
